Projected Savings Associated with Lowering the Risk of Total Hip Arthroplasty Revision Due to Dislocation in Patients with Spinopelvic Pathology. CLINICOECONOMICS AND OUTCOMES RESEARCH 2023; 15:321-330. Abstract
Purpose In the United States (US), total hip arthroplasty (THA) is the most common hospital inpatient operation among Medicare beneficiaries and is ranked fourth when considering all payers. Spinopelvic pathology (SPP) is associated with an increased risk of THA revision (rTHA) due to dislocation. Several strategies have been proposed to mitigate the risk of instability in this population, including use of dual-mobility implants, anterior-based surgical approaches, and technology-assistance (digital 2D/3D pre-surgical planning, computer navigation, and robotic assistance). For primary THA (pTHA) patients with SPP who subsequently undergo rTHA due to dislocation, we aimed to estimate (1) target population size; (2) economic burden; and (3) 10-year projected savings to the US payer of lowering the risk of rTHA due to dislocation among pTHA patients with SPP. Methods A budget impact analysis from the US payer perspective was undertaken using published literature; American Academy of Orthopaedic Surgeons American Joint Replacement Registry 2021 Annual Report; Centers for Medicare & Medicaid Services MEDPAR 2019; and National (Nationwide) Inpatient Sample (NIS) 2019. Expenditures were inflation-adjusted to 2021 US dollars using the Medical Care component of the Consumer Price Index. Sensitivity analyses were performed. Results The target population size in 2021 was estimated at 5040 (range, 4830-6309) for Medicare (fee-for-service plus Medicare Advantage) and 8003 (range, 7669-10,018) for all-payer. Annual rTHA episode-of-care (through 90 days) expenditures for Medicare and all-payer were $185 million and $314 million, respectively. Using a 4.14% compound annual growth rate from NIS, the estimated number of applicable rTHA procedures that will be performed from 2022-2031 was 63,419 Medicare and 100,697 all-payer. With each 10% reduction in relative risk of rTHA due to dislocation, Medicare and all-payer could save $233 million and $395 million, respectively, over a 10-year period. Conclusion Among pTHA patients with spinopelvic pathology, a modest reduction in the risk of rTHA due to dislocation could achieve substantial cumulative savings to payers while improving healthcare quality.

Cost-Utility Analysis of Sacroiliac Joint Fusion in High-Risk Patients Undergoing Multi-Level Lumbar Fusion to the Sacrum. CLINICOECONOMICS AND OUTCOMES RESEARCH 2022; 14:523-535. Abstract
Purpose Multi-level lumbar fusion to the sacrum (MLF) can lead to increased stress and angular motion across the sacroiliac joint (SIJ), with an incidence of post-operative SIJ pain estimated at 26–32%. SIJ fusion (SIJF) can help obviate the need for revisions by reducing range of motion and screw stresses. We aimed to evaluate the cost-utility of MLF + SIJF compared to MLF alone among high-risk patients from a payer perspective, where high risk is defined as high body mass index and high pelvic incidence. Methods A Markov process decision-analysis model was developed to evaluate cumulative 5-year costs, quality-adjusted life years (QALYs), and incremental cost-effectiveness ratio (ICER) of MLF + SIJF compared to MLF alone using published data; costs from Medicare claims data analyses and health state utility values (derived from EQ-5D) informed by three prospective, multicenter, clinical trials. The base case assumed a reduction in post-operative SIJ pain from 30% to 10% (relative risk reduction [RRR] of 67%). Costs and utilities were discounted 3% annually. The ICER is reported in 2020 US dollars. One-way, multi-way, and probabilistic sensitivity analyses were performed. Results With an assumed 30% incidence of SIJ pain after MLF alone, stabilizing with SIJF was associated with an additional 5-year cost of $2421 and a gain of 0.14 QALYs, resulting in an ICER of $17,293 per QALY gained (similar to total knee arthroplasty and more favorable than open discectomy). ICERs were most sensitive to the RRR of post-operative SIJ pain conferred by SIJF, time horizon, and probability of successful treatment with MLF alone. At a willingness-to-pay threshold of $50,000/QALY gained, MLF + SIJF has a 97.7% probability of being cost-effective in the target patient population. Conclusion Fusing the SIJ in high-risk patients undergoing MLF was cost-effective when the incidence of post-operative SIJ pain after MLF alone exceeds approximately 25%, providing value-based healthcare from a payer perspective.

Health care utilization and costs following amplified versus non-amplified molecular probe testing for symptomatic patients with suspected vulvovaginitis: a US commercial payer population. CLINICOECONOMICS AND OUTCOMES RESEARCH 2019; 11:179-189. Abstract
Background Vulvovaginitis (VV) is a common reason women seek medical attention in the USA. Both the non-specific clinical presentation and risk of preterm labor or delivery necessitate accurate identification of the causative agents to guide appropriate therapy. The diagnostic accuracy of amplified molecular probe testing (AMP) has been shown to exceed that of non-amplified molecular probe (NAMP) by 20%–25%. Objective To evaluate the impact of diagnosis with AMP testing on health care utilization, direct costs, and health outcomes, compared with NAMP, for symptomatic patients with suspected VV from a commercial payer perspective. Methods Symptomatic women (aged 18–64 years) who underwent VV testing with AMP or NAMP from January 1, 2012–December 31, 2016 were identified using the Truven Health Analytics MarketScan Database; those with continuous medical and pharmacy benefit enrollment 6 months pre/post AMP or NAMP testing were included. Patients were propensity score (PS) matched and 6-month all-cause health care resource utilization, all-cause direct costs (2017 USD), risk of all-cause hospitalization, and risk of preterm labor or delivery were compared between cohorts. Results After PS match (N=46,810 per group, mean age 34.2 years), AMP had significantly (all P<0.0001) fewer mean hospital outpatient visits (AMP 0.9 vs NAMP 1.0), primary care physician office visits (AMP 1.1 vs NAMP 1.2), and prescription medications (AMP 7.3 vs NAMP 8.0), and a 21% reduction in risk of hospitalization (risk ratio [RR]=0.79, 95% CI= 0.75–0.83, P<0.0001). Total medical expenditures per patient were lower for AMP than NAMP (mean AMP $3,287 vs NAMP $3,555, P<0.0001). Among pregnant women (N=2,175 per group), AMP had a 12% reduction in risk of preterm labor or delivery (RR =0.88, 95% CI=0.77–0.99, P=0.041). Conclusion This real-world study offers evidence on the clinical utility for symptomatic patients with suspected VV diagnosed with AMP compared to NAMP – demonstrating an opportunity to improve the patient journey while delivering value-based care.

Projected Medicare Savings Associated With Lowering the Risk of Total Hip Arthroplasty Revision: An Administrative Claims Data Analysis. Orthopedics 2019; 42:e86-e92. Abstract
In the United States, demand for total hip arthroplasty (THA) and THA revision procedures are increasing due to an aging population, a longer life expectancy, and an increasing prevalence of osteoarthritis. This retrospective cohort study identified patients 65 years and older in the Medicare 5% Standard Analytic Files who underwent THA for osteoarthritis between January 1, 2009, and September 30, 2010. The authors estimated the 5-year cumulative revision risk (CRR) using the Kaplan-Meier method, revision-related complications, and Medicare expenditures. Using a 6.22% compound annual growth rate from the Healthcare Cost and Utilization Project of the Agency for Healthcare Research and Quality, the authors estimated the number of THAs that will be performed from 2018 to 2027 and calculated the 10-year projected savings to Medicare for a 1% reduction in CRR. Among 7820 patients, the mean age was 74.4 years, and 62.4% were female. Cumulative revision risk was 4.2% at 5 years (through September 30, 2015), with 30.8% of revisions occurring within 90 days of the THA. At least 24.4% of revision patients had a complication. Median revision inpatient stay and episode of care (through 90 days) expenditures were $23,847 and $36,157, respectively. With a 1% absolute reduction in CRR, Medicare could save $697 million over a 10-year period, or $985 million when including Medicare Advantage, which represented 29.2% of 2016 Medicare payments. Strategies to reduce the risk of THA revision, such as the use of implant constructs with lower CRR and value-based payment models, are needed to achieve Medicare payment reductions while maintaining or improving quality of care for Medicare beneficiaries. Cost analysis of a growth guidance system compared with traditional and magnetically controlled growing rods for early-onset scoliosis: a US-based integrated health care delivery system perspective. CLINICOECONOMICS AND OUTCOMES RESEARCH 2018; 10:179-187. Abstract
Purpose Treating early-onset scoliosis (EOS) with traditional growing rods (TGR) is effective but requires periodic surgical lengthening, risking complications. Alternatives include magnetically controlled growing rods (MCGR) that lengthen noninvasively and the growth guidance system (GGS), which obviate the need for active, distractive lengthenings. Previous studies have reported promising clinical effectiveness for GGS; however the direct medical costs of GGS compared to TGR and MCGR have not yet been explored. Methods To estimate the cost of GGS compared with MCGR and TGR for EOS an economic model was developed from the perspective of a US integrated health care delivery system. Using dual-rod constructs, the model estimated the cumulative costs associated with initial implantation, rod lengthenings (TGR, MCGR), revisions due to device failure, surgical-site infections, device exchange, and final spinal fusion over a 6-year episode of care. Model parameters were from peer-reviewed, published literature. Medicare payments were used as a proxy for provider costs. Costs (2016 US$) were discounted 3% annually. Results Over a 6-year episode of care, GGS was associated with fewer invasive surgeries per patient than TGR (GGS: 3.4; TGR: 14.4) and lower cumulative costs than MCGR and TGR, saving $25,226 vs TGR. Sensitivity analyses showed that results were sensitive to changes in construct costs, rod breakage rates, months between lengthenings, and TGR lengthening setting of care. Conclusion Within the model, GGS resulted in fewer invasive surgeries and deep surgical site infections than TGR, and lower cumulative costs per patient than both MCGR and TGR, over a 6-year episode of care. The analysis did not account for family disruption, pain, psychological distress, or compromised health-related quality of life associated with invasive TGR lengthenings, nor for potential patient anxiety surrounding the frequent MCGR lengthenings. Further analyses focusing strictly on current generation technologies should be considered for future research.

Cost analysis of magnetically controlled growing rods compared with traditional growing rods for early-onset scoliosis in the US: an integrated health care delivery system perspective. CLINICOECONOMICS AND OUTCOMES RESEARCH 2016; 8:457-465. Abstract
Purpose Traditional growing rod (TGR) for early-onset scoliosis (EOS) is effective but requires repeated invasive surgical lengthenings under general anesthesia. Magnetically controlled growing rod (MCGR) is lengthened noninvasively using a hand-held magnetic external remote controller in a physician office; however, the MCGR implant is expensive, and the cumulative cost savings have not been well studied. We compared direct medical costs of MCGR and TGR for EOS from the US integrated health care delivery system perspective. We hypothesized that over time, the MCGR implant cost will be offset by eliminating repeated TGR surgical lengthenings. Methods For both TGR and MCGR, the economic model estimated the cumulative costs for initial implantation, lengthenings, revisions due to device failure, surgical-site infections, device exchanges (at 3.8 years), and final fusion, over a 6-year episode of care. Model parameters were estimated from published literature, a multicenter EOS database of US institutions, and interviews. Costs were discounted at 3.0% annually and represent 2015 US dollars. Results Of 1,000 simulated patients over 6 years, MCGR was associated with an estimated 270 fewer deep surgical-site infections and 197 fewer revisions due to device failure compared with TGR. MCGR was projected to cost an additional $61 per patient over the 6-year episode of care compared with TGR. Sensitivity analyses indicated that the results were sensitive to changes in the percentage of MCGR dual rod use, months between TGR lengthenings, percentage of hospital inpatient (vs outpatient) TGR lengthenings, and MCGR implant cost. Conclusion Cost neutrality of MCGR to TGR was achieved over the 6-year episode of care by eliminating repeated TGR surgical lengthenings. To our knowledge, this is the first cost analysis comparing MCGR to TGR – from the US provider perspective – which demonstrates the efficient provision of care with MCGR.

What would be the annual cost savings if fewer screws were used in adolescent idiopathic scoliosis treatment in the US? J Neurosurg Spine 2016; 24:116-23. Abstract
OBJECT
There is substantial heterogeneity in the number of screws used per level fused in adolescent idiopathic scoliosis (AIS) surgery. Assuming equivalent clinical outcomes, the potential cost savings of using fewer pedicle screws were estimated using a medical decision model with sensitivity analysis.
METHODS
Descriptive analyses explored the annual costs for 5710 AIS inpatient stays using discharge data from the 2009 Kids’ Inpatient Database (Healthcare Cost and Utilization Project, Agency for Healthcare Research and Quality), which is a national all-payer inpatient database. Patients between 10 and 17 years of age were identified using the ICD-9-CM code for idiopathic scoliosis (737.30). All inpatient stays were assumed to represent 10-level fusions with pedicle screws for AIS. High screw density was defined at 1.8 screws per level fused, and the standard screw density was defined as 1.48 screws per level fused. The surgical return for screw malposition was set at $23,762. A sensitivity analysis was performed by varying the cost per screw ($600–$1000) and the rate of surgical revisions for screw malposition (0.117%–0.483% of screws; 0.8%–4.3% of patients). The reported outcomes include estimated prevented malpositioned screws (set at 5.1%), averted revision surgeries, and annual cost savings in 2009 US dollars, assuming similar clinical outcomes (rates of complications, revision) using a standard- versus high-density pattern.
RESULTS
The total annual costs for 5710 AIS hospital stays was $278 million ($48,900 per patient). Substituting a high for a standard screw density yields 3.2 fewer screws implanted per patient, with 932 malpositioned screws prevented and 21 to 88 revision surgeries for implant malposition averted, and a potential annual cost savings of $11 million to $20 million (4%–7% reduction in the total cost of AIS hospitalizations).
CONCLUSIONS
Reducing the number of screws used in scoliosis surgery could potentially decrease national AIS hospitalization costs by up to 7%, which may improve the safety and efficiency of care. However, such a screw construct must first be proven safe and effective.

Nonoperative care to manage sacroiliac joint disruption and degenerative sacroiliitis: high costs and medical resource utilization in the United States Medicare population. J Neurosurg Spine 2014; 20:354-63. Abstract
OBJECT Low-back pain (LBP) is highly prevalent among older adults, and the cost to treat the US Medicare population is substantial. Recent US health care reform legislation focuses on improving quality of care and reducing costs. The sacroiliac (SI) joint is a recognized generator of LBP, but treatments traditionally have included either nonoperative medical management or open SI joint fusion, which has a high rate of complications. New minimally invasive technologies have been developed to treat SI joint disruption and degenerative sacroiliitis, so it is important to understand the current cost impact of nonoperative care to the Medicare program. The objective of this study was to evaluate the medical resource use and associated Medicare reimbursement for patients managed with nonoperative care for degenerative sacroiliitis/SI joint disruption. METHODS A retrospective study was conducted using claim-level data from the Medicare 5% Standard Analytical Files (SAFs) for the years 2005-2010. Included were patients with a primary ICD-9-CM (International Classification of Diseases, Ninth Revision, Clinical Modification) diagnosis code for degenerative sacroiliitis/SI joint disruption (ICD-9-CM diagnosis codes 720.2, 724.6, 739.4, 846.9, or 847.3) with continuous enrollment for at least 1 year before and 5 years after diagnosis. Claims attributable to degenerative sacroiliitis/SI joint disruption were identified using ICD-9-CM diagnosis codes (claims with a primary or secondary ICD-9-CM diagnosis code of 71x.xx, 72x.xx, 73x.xx, or 84x.xx), and the 5-year medical resource use and Medicare reimbursement (in 2012 US dollars) were tabulated across practice settings. A subgroup analysis was performed among patients who underwent lumbar spinal fusion. RESULTS Among all Medicare patients with degenerative sacroiliitis or SI joint disruption (n = 14,552), the mean cumulative 5-year direct medical costs attributable to degenerative sacroiliitis/SI joint disruption was $18,527 ± $28,285 (± SD) per patient. The cumulative 5-year cost was $63,913 ± $46,870 per patient among the subgroup of patients who underwent lumbar spinal fusion (n = 538 [3.7%]) and $16,769 ± $25,753 per patient among the subgroup of patients who had not undergone lumbar spinal fusion (n = 14,014 [96.3%]). For the total population, the largest proportion of cumulative 5-year costs was due to inpatient hospitalization (42.1%), outpatient physician office (20.6%), and hospital outpatient costs (14.9%). The estimated cumulative 5-year Medicare reimbursement across practice settings attributable to SI joint disruption or degenerative sacroiliitis is approximately $270 million among these 14,552 Medicare beneficiaries ($18,527 per patient). CONCLUSIONS In patients who suffer from LBP due to SI joint disruption or degenerative sacroiliitis, this retrospective Medicare claims data analysis demonstrates that nonoperative care is associated with substantial costs and medical resource utilization. The economic burden of SI joint disruption and degenerative sacroiliitis among Medicare beneficiaries in the US is substantial and highlights the need for more cost-effective therapies to treat this condition and reduce health care expenditures.

Economic consequences of alterations in platelet transfusion dose: analysis of a prospective, randomized, double-blind trial. Transfusion 2000; 40:1457-62. Abstract
BACKGROUND In recent years, decreasing financial resources led to the use of lower-dose platelet components. However, the economic consequences of the use of such components have not been carefully studied. STUDY DESIGN AND METHODS A formal economic analysis was conducted of a recently reported, prospective, randomized, double-blind study examining the platelet dose-response relationship in nonrefractory patients. The economic analysis used a decision analysis model, conducted from the hospital's perspective and based directly on the observed clinical data and on institutional cost structures. RESULTS The decision analysis model estimated that a 38-percent reduction in mean platelet dose, within the commonly prescribed dose range, would result in the average patient's requiring approximately 60 percent more transfusions in the posttransplant period (8 vs. 5; p = 0.05), which would result in an estimated 60-percent increase in the median cost to the hospital ($4486/patient vs. $2804/patient [in 1996 US dollars], p = 0.05). CONCLUSION Efforts to decrease costs by utilizing lower-dose single-donor platelet transfusions are predicted to result in a disproportionate increase in the number of transfusions per patient, with a corresponding increase in overall hospital transfusion costs.

Clinical consequences of alterations in platelet transfusion dose: a prospective, randomized, double-blind trial. Transfusion 1999; 39:674-81. Abstract
BACKGROUND The dose-response relationship for platelet transfusion has become increasingly important as the use of platelet transfusion has grown. STUDY DESIGN AND METHODS One hundred fifty-eight prophylactic apheresis platelet transfusions were administered to 46 patients undergoing high-dose therapy followed by hematopoietic progenitor cell transplantation in a prospective, randomized, double-blind, multiple-crossover study. Transfusions were administered in pairs, differing only in platelet content. Each pair consisted of a lower-dose platelet component (LDP) and a higher-dose platelet component (HDP) administered in random order to the same patient. LDPs contained a mean of 3.1 x 10(11) platelets (range, 2.3-3.5 x 10(11)), and HDPs contained a mean of 5.0 x 10(11) platelets (range, 4.5-6.1 x 10(11)). Patients with active bleeding and those who were refractory to platelet transfusions were excluded. RESULTS The mean posttransfusion platelet count increment with LDP was 17,010 per microL, and that with HDP was 31,057 per microL (p<0.0001). Only 37 percent of LDPs resulted in platelet count increments of at least 20,000 per microL, whereas 81 percent of HDPs resulted in increments above this level (p<0.0001). The mean transfusion-free interval with LDP was 2.16 days, whereas that with HDP was 3.03 days (p<0.01). Administration of LDPs was associated with a 39 to 82 percent increase in the relative risk (per day) of requiring subsequent platelet transfusions (p<0.0001). CONCLUSION As compared to the administration of HDPs, the administration of LDPs for prophylactic transfusion in hematopoietic progenitor cell transplant patients results in a lower platelet count increment, a lower likelihood of obtaining a posttransfusion platelet increment >20,000 per microL, a shorter transfusion-free interval, and a greater relative risk per day of requiring additional transfusions.
